The 1900 census records Hattie R Price appears as the wife of Isaac Jefferson Briscoe in Parker County, Texas. She is his 3rd wife.
1900 Federal Census, Parker County, Texas, 4 June, Voting Precinct 4 Outside Weatherford, District 65, Page 2B, House #26, Family #27
Briscoe, Isaac J Head W M Jun 1832 67 Married 19 years MO TN TN Farmer Owns Farm
Briscoe, Hattie R Wife W F Aug 1843 56 Married 19 years 6 children/6 living MS TN TN
Briscoe, Sarah Dau W F May 1883 17 Single TX MO MS At School
Briscoe, Henry Son W F Feby 1885 15 Single TX MO MS Farm Laborer
Note that this census reports that Hattie was born in Mississippi. I have found that most genealogies report no place of birth.
In 1910, Hattie (nickname for Harriet) is spelled as Hettie, usually a short form of Hester. Isaac and Hettie/Hattie's son Henry and his wife Lena are living in their household.

I find her name as Hattie or Hettie in various sources. S H Norton, in comments on Isaac Jefferson Briscoe's obituary, refers to her as Hettie, as some genealogies do. Hattie's own obit spells her name as Hattie. Hattie may have been her actual name, or it may have been a nickname for her full name Harriet. I have not seen a record with her name as Harriet. In the 1920 census she is again Hettie.

Notice that the name in her obit is spelled Brisco. The surname is spelled both ways in family and public records over the decades. It is generally spelled with the E.
============================
MRS. BRISCO DEAD
Mrs. Hattie Brisco, widow of the late I.J. Brisco, died at the family home in the Harmony community Friday morning [31 Dec 1920] at 4:30, following an illness of several days. Mrs. Brisco was 77 years of age and has been a resident of this county for many years. She is survived by six children as follows: Mrs. R.W. Brisco, Altus, Oklahoma; Mrs J.R. Wooley, Elmer, Okla.: Mrs. D.M. Bull, Weatherford; Mrs. W.M. Staggs, Gallup, Okla.; Henry Briscoe, Weatherford and Mrs. Arthur Wooley at home.
Funeral services will be held at the Harmony church, Saturday afternoon [8 January 1921] at 2:30 o'clock by Rev. C.H. Ray with burial at the Harmony cemetery.
-- Weekly Herald (Weatherford, Texas), Thursday, 6 January 1921

Her information in the Harmony Cemetery registry lists her as Hattie Price. This source says she was the wife of first husband Levi Highton then second husband I J Briscoe.
"Briscoe Hattie Price b Aug 14 1843 d 31 December 1920 wife of 1st Levi Highton 2nd I J Briscoe"
-- Parker County Genealogical Society, Harmony Cemetery (Parker County, Texas)
